Form 4: Upstart Holdings Corporate Controller Sells Shares Under 10b5-1 Plan

Sentiment:

SEC Form 4


Natalia Mirgorodskaya, Corporate Controller of Upstart Holdings, sold 959 shares of common stock at $40.32 per share on September 30, 2024, under a pre-arranged Rule 10b5-1 trading plan.

Summary

  • On September 30, 2024, Natalia Mirgorodskaya, the Corporate Controller of Upstart Holdings, sold 959 shares of common stock.
  • The sale was executed at a price of $40.32 per share.
  • The transaction was conducted under a Rule 10b5-1 trading plan adopted on May 30, 2024.
  • Following the transaction, Mirgorodskaya directly owns 21,518 shares of Upstart Holdings, Inc.
  • Some of these securities are restricted stock units (RSUs), each representing a contingent right to receive one share of Common Stock, subject to vesting conditions.

Industry Context

Sales by corporate insiders are a common occurrence and are often scrutinized by investors. Sales under 10b5-1 plans are generally viewed as less concerning since they are pre-arranged and not based on current insider information.
